Every Monday evening in Carrick-on-Suir, this Narcotics Anonymous group meets at the Nano Nagle Community Resource Centre on Greenside. The venue sits opposite the park, which makes it easy to find if you're coming into town for the first time. Meetings start at 20:00 and run for about an hour, giving members a regular midweek anchor. This is a closed meeting, so it's set aside for people who share a desire to stop using drugs, offering a private space to talk honestly among others who understand. If you're thinking about coming along, there's nothing to arrange in advance and no cost to attend. Just turn up a few minutes before eight and take a seat.
Who can attend this meeting?
This is a closed NA meeting, which means it's for people who have a desire to stop using drugs. If that's you, you're welcome. Open meetings, by contrast, welcome anyone including family and friends, but this one is kept for members so people can share freely.
Do I need to book or pay anything?
No. There's no booking, no fee and no need to register. NA is free to attend and self-supporting through members' own contributions. Just arrive a little before 20:00 on Monday and join the group.
Where exactly is the venue?
The meeting is held at the Nano Nagle Community Resource Centre on Greenside, Carrick-on-Suir (E92 P928). It's directly opposite the park, which is a handy landmark to look out for as you approach.
